UPDATE: Father and son reach goal of $57,000 raised for BC Children’s Hospital
PRINCE GEORGE–A Prince George father and son who have spent the last eight years raising money for the BC Children’s hospital have finally reached their goal.
Rajinder Sharma and his 11-year old son Sunjai have been collecting cans and bottles for years to give back to the hospital. At birth, Sunjai had a condition called sagittal synostosis, causing his skull to prematurely fuse, preventing proper brain growth.
The hospital had to perform surgery, leaving him with 57 stitches. The two wanted to be able to give back to the hospital so they came up with an idea: $1,000 raised for every stitch he was given.
